WebDec 12, 2024 · 1. Compressed Air Dew Point. Dew point (DP) is the temperature at which your compressed air becomes fully saturated so that it cannot hold any more water vapor. This saturation causes condensation. In other words, dew point is the temperature when water vapor becomes liquid. The dew point is a little more abstract than relative humidity, but it’s an efficient technique for determining how much moisture is in the air because it implies the same thing regardless of how warm or cold it is outside.. A dew point of 40°F is acceptable regardless of whether the air temperature is 60°F or 100°F.
